Abstract

Soybean Glicine max (L.) Merr is the main protein agricultural crop in the Far East of the Russian Federation. The seed content of the valuable nutritional matter makes it one of the main agricultural crops in many countries of the world. Genetic variability and relations of the seven variety samples of soybean used in the selection process, were studied using marking method. Usage of the six ISSR-primers allowed to define variability of 47 ISSR-fragments when 68 % of them were polymorphic. Indices of genetic distances varied from 0,1456 till 0,3879.
